当前位置:首页 > 科技 > 正文

路由器与哈希表扩容:网络传输与数据管理的交响曲

  • 科技
  • 2025-10-31 12:50:22
  • 4680
摘要: 在当今数字化时代,路由器和哈希表扩容策略如同网络传输与数据管理的交响曲,各自扮演着不可或缺的角色。路由器作为网络传输的指挥家,负责将数据从一个网络传输到另一个网络;而哈希表扩容策略则像是数据管理的指挥家,确保数据在存储过程中高效、有序。本文将深入探讨这两者...

在当今数字化时代,路由器和哈希表扩容策略如同网络传输与数据管理的交响曲,各自扮演着不可或缺的角色。路由器作为网络传输的指挥家,负责将数据从一个网络传输到另一个网络;而哈希表扩容策略则像是数据管理的指挥家,确保数据在存储过程中高效、有序。本文将深入探讨这两者之间的关联,揭示它们如何共同构建起高效、稳定的网络环境。

# 一、路由器:网络传输的指挥家

路由器,作为网络传输的关键设备,其主要职责是将数据从一个网络传输到另一个网络。它通过分析数据包的目的地址,选择最佳路径进行传输。路由器的工作原理可以分为以下几个步骤:

1. 接收数据包:路由器首先接收来自其他设备的数据包。

2. 解析数据包:路由器解析数据包中的IP地址,确定数据包的目的地。

3. 路径选择:路由器根据路由表选择最佳路径,将数据包转发到下一个路由器或目标设备。

4. 传输数据包:路由器将数据包封装到适当的物理层协议中,通过网络介质进行传输。

路由器的性能直接影响到整个网络的传输效率。为了提高路由器的性能,通常会采用多种技术,如多线程处理、高速缓存、负载均衡等。这些技术不仅提高了路由器的处理能力,还确保了数据传输的稳定性和可靠性。

路由器与哈希表扩容:网络传输与数据管理的交响曲

# 二、哈希表扩容策略:数据管理的指挥家

哈希表是一种高效的数据结构,广泛应用于数据库、缓存系统、搜索引擎等领域。哈希表通过将键映射到存储位置来实现快速查找。然而,随着数据量的增加,哈希表可能会出现“哈希冲突”现象,即多个键映射到同一个存储位置。为了解决这一问题,哈希表扩容策略应运而生。

哈希表扩容策略主要包括以下几种方法:

路由器与哈希表扩容:网络传输与数据管理的交响曲

1. 线性探测:当发生哈希冲突时,线性探测会依次检查下一个存储位置,直到找到空闲位置为止。

2. 链地址法:每个存储位置关联一个链表,当发生哈希冲突时,将冲突的键值存储在链表中。

3. 二次探测:当发生哈希冲突时,二次探测会使用二次多项式函数来确定下一个存储位置。

路由器与哈希表扩容:网络传输与数据管理的交响曲

4. 开放地址法:开放地址法通过计算下一个存储位置来解决哈希冲突,常见的有二次探测和双重哈希法。

哈希表扩容策略不仅能够有效解决哈希冲突问题,还能提高哈希表的查找效率。例如,链地址法通过将冲突的键值存储在链表中,可以避免线性探测带来的性能下降;二次探测和双重哈希法则通过计算下一个存储位置,提高了查找效率。

# 三、路由器与哈希表扩容策略的关联

路由器与哈希表扩容:网络传输与数据管理的交响曲

路由器和哈希表扩容策略看似风马牛不相及,实则在数据传输和存储过程中存在着密切的联系。首先,路由器在传输过程中需要处理大量的数据包,这些数据包往往需要存储在缓存系统中。此时,哈希表扩容策略可以确保缓存系统的高效运行。其次,路由器在选择最佳路径时,需要对大量的路由信息进行快速查找。此时,哈希表扩容策略可以提高路由信息的查找效率,从而提高路由器的性能。

具体来说,路由器在处理大量数据包时,需要将这些数据包存储在缓存系统中。此时,哈希表扩容策略可以确保缓存系统的高效运行。例如,在Web服务器中,缓存系统可以将频繁访问的网页内容存储在哈希表中。当用户再次访问这些网页时,路由器可以直接从缓存系统中获取数据包,而无需重新从服务器获取。这样不仅可以提高数据传输效率,还可以减轻服务器的负担。

此外,路由器在选择最佳路径时,需要对大量的路由信息进行快速查找。此时,哈希表扩容策略可以提高路由信息的查找效率。例如,在大型网络中,路由器需要处理大量的路由信息。此时,可以使用哈希表扩容策略来提高路由信息的查找效率。具体来说,可以使用链地址法将冲突的路由信息存储在链表中,从而避免线性探测带来的性能下降。这样不仅可以提高路由器的性能,还可以提高整个网络的传输效率。

路由器与哈希表扩容:网络传输与数据管理的交响曲

# 四、结论

路由器和哈希表扩容策略虽然看似风马牛不相及,实则在数据传输和存储过程中存在着密切的联系。路由器作为网络传输的指挥家,负责将数据从一个网络传输到另一个网络;而哈希表扩容策略则像是数据管理的指挥家,确保数据在存储过程中高效、有序。通过合理运用这两种技术,可以构建起高效、稳定的网络环境。未来,随着技术的发展,路由器和哈希表扩容策略将会更加紧密地结合在一起,共同推动数字化时代的进步。

总之,路由器和哈希表扩容策略在数据传输和存储过程中发挥着重要作用。通过合理运用这两种技术,可以构建起高效、稳定的网络环境。未来,随着技术的发展,这两种技术将会更加紧密地结合在一起,共同推动数字化时代的进步。

路由器与哈希表扩容:网络传输与数据管理的交响曲